Abstract
(±)-10,10-Dimethylprostaglandin E1 methyl ester (28) and its 15-epimer (32) have been synthesised in 20 steps from the readily available 2,2-dimethylcyclopentane-1,3-dione (1). The key step in the synthesis, selective reduction of the C-2 carbonyl function of ethyl 5-(6-ethoxycarbonylhexyl)-3,3-dimethyl-2,4-dioxocyclopentanecarboxylate (9) to give the corresponding all-trans-hydroxycyclopentanone derivative (11), has been achieved by catalytic hydrogenation over Adams catalyst.
